FMEA学习(2软件)

软件FMEA是一种评估方法,专注于软件功能,旨在识别和预防可能导致系统故障的因素。它涉及梳理软件需求、分析变量、识别单点故障、评估接口安全性和故障管理策略。设计时考虑故障模式、冗余实现、故障安全模式和早期警告,以确保即使在故障情况下也能保持系统安全状态。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

软件FMEA评估系统设计的能力,通过其软件设计表达,以可预测的方式作出反应,以确保系统安全。软件FMEA类似于系统或设计FMEA,只是软件FMEA主要关注软件功能。

软件FMEA包括内容:

1、捋顺软件需求,防止需求丢失

2、分析传递及输出变量

3、分析系统来自系统外部请求响应时的输出动作

4、识别可能导致不可挽回故障的单点故障

5、分析功能之外的接口

6、识别软件对硬件异常的安全故障机制策略

软件设计应考虑出故障还能安全

1、设计出故障模式

2、利用冗余实现容错

3、进入故障安全模式

4、实施早期预警报

       无论什么原因导致软件出现故障,软件都应该始终处于期望的状态。如果在规范中没有确定所需的状态,软件应进入故障安全状态。 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值